Software Security Engineer (Entry-Level)
Role details
Job location
Tech stack
Job description
- Secure Product Development:
- Assist in the implementation and maintenance of security standards and best practices.
- Help identify, triage, and track remediation of vulnerabilities.
- Contribute to the integration and tuning of security tools (SAST, SCA, DAST, secrets scanning, etc.).
- Provide guidance and support to engineers regarding security requirements.
- Participate and guide product teams in threat modeling to identify potential risks using STRIDE and DREAD frameworks.
- Automation & Scripting:
- Develop and maintain automation scripts (Python, Bash, PowerShell, etc.) to improve security processes and workflows.
- Create small internal tools or utilities that support engineering productivity and security visibility.
- Systems & Tool Administration:
- Help manage and administer security-related platforms (e.g., SAST, DAST, SCA scanners).
- Assist with onboarding engineers to security tools and workflows.
- Support documentation efforts for operational procedures and tool usage.
- Collaboration & Continuous Improvement:
- Work closely with software engineers, DevOps, and IT to promote secure practices.
- Participate in security incident response activities as needed.
- Stay up to date with emerging security trends, threats, and technologies.
Requirements
We're looking for a motivated, early-career engineer with a strong technical foundation and a passion for cybersecurity. In this role, you will support Secure Product Development initiatives across the engineering organization, including secure coding, tool administration, automation scripting, vulnerability management, and advising software engineers on security requirements. This is a great opportunity for someone eager to grow their skills and contribute to building a secure-by-design engineering culture., * Bachelor's degree in Computer Science, Computer Engineering, Information Security, or a related technical field.
- Strong familiarity with one or more scripting languages (e.g., Python, Bash, PowerShell).
- Working knowledge of Linux and/or Windows operating systems.
- Understanding of core cybersecurity topics such as OWASP Top 10, SSDLC, and common vulnerability types.
- Ability to learn new tools, technologies, and security concepts quickly.
- Strong communication and documentation skills., * Coursework, internships, or projects related to cybersecurity.
- Exposure to cloud platforms (AWS, Azure, or GCP).
- Familiarity with GitHub or similar version control systems.
- Experience with CI/CD pipelines or developer tooling.
- Basic knowledge of networking fundamentals and security protocols.
- Relevant certifications (Security+, GSEC, etc.) are a plus but not required.
What We're Looking For
This role is ideal for someone who:
- Has a strong technical grounding and wants to specialize in security.
- Enjoys problem-solving, debugging, and understanding how systems work.
- Is proactive, curious, and eager to grow within a security-focused career path.
- Thrives in a collaborative engineering environment.
Benefits & conditions
This position is also eligible for bonus as part of the total compensation package.
Pay Range
The salary range for this position (in local currency) is 63900.00-118700.00